The state of Utah is sitting on tens of millions of dollars, and a sliver of it might be yours.
The Utah Unclaimed Property Division obtained $66.7 million in misplaced property throughout 2021, stemming from dormant financial institution accounts, overpaid medical payments, uncashed checks and unpaid insurance coverage advantages. That provides to the $370 million balloon that the division has acquired through the years.
More often than not it’s cash. However typically the contents of an deserted secure deposit field will be claimed. That features gadgets like collectible cash, army medals, artwork and images — even a set of dentures.

Utahns can search their identify utilizing the state’s web site, mycash.utah.gov, and file a declare if they've unclaimed property or money. There’s likelihood — 20%, to be actual — that your identify is within the database.
“One in 5 Utahns has misplaced cash, they usually in all probability don’t realize it. I had no concept I had misplaced cash till I grew to become state treasurer and realized about an overpaid medical invoice,” Utah Treasurer Marlo M. Oaks stated in a press launch.
When a enterprise owes cash to somebody it will probably’t discover, after three years it palms the cash over to the state, which then provides the proprietor’s identify to its database.
Final yr, the state returned $36 million in unclaimed funds to Utahns. Usually it returns about half of the cash acquired every year, says Brittany Griffin with the Utah Workplace of State Treasurer, however it’s inevitable that some house owners won't ever test the database.
Typically firms report unclaimed property that doesn’t have an proprietor, and there are probably tens of millions that can by no means be claimed.
Annually, the workplace donates a portion of that cash to the state’s Uniform College Fund.
